What is the gradient of the straight line parallel to the straight line y = 2x + 4?

Solution 1

To find the gradient of a straight line parallel to the line y = 2x + 4, we can observe that parallel lines have the same gradient.

The given line is in the form y = mx + c, where m represents the gradient. In this case, the gradient is 2.
